TldFanoutAction fans out a given endpoint to all TLDs (either TEST, REAL, or both). However, it is also used to delegate a single endpoint request that we want set in a specific queue (so we can control retries). We do that by setting the TLD list to "runInEmpty" rather than "forEachRealTld" or "forEachTestTld". Currently, using "runInEmpty" would still specify a TLD - but that TLD would be the empty string. This is a bug: it sets the TLD parameter to a bad value. It worked only because none of the endpoints called with "runInEmpty" were using the TLD parameter. However, this will (and does) break if either (a) the endpoint accepts an optional TLD parameter (like deleteProberData does), or (b) the given endpoint already has a TLD parameter in it (we want to run the endpoint with a single TLD, but still use the "fanout" to set the right queue). This CL fixes several things: - if runInEmpty is given, no TLD parameter is added - 'runInEmpty' is now mutually exclusive with 'forEach*Tld' and 'excludes' - we do some sanity checks and added logging - removed the buggy and unused "':tld' in path is replaced by TLD" - in the cron.xml, removed documentation for :tld and the broken :registrar Note that none of the endpoints that were used with runInEmpty fanout had the TLD parameter prior to deleteProberData ------------- Created by MOE: https://github.com/google/moe MOE_MIGRATED_REVID=189954585

/**
|
|
* Action for fanning out cron tasks shared by TLD.
|
|
*
|
|
* <h3>Parameters Reference</h3>
|
|
*
|
|
* <ul>
|
|
* <li>{@code endpoint} (Required) URL path of servlet to launch. This may contain pathargs.
|
|
* <li>{@code queue} (Required) Name of the App Engine push queue to which this task should be sent.
|
|
* <li>{@code forEachRealTld} Launch the task in each real TLD namespace.
|
|
* <li>{@code forEachTestTld} Launch the task in each test TLD namespace.
|
|
* <li>{@code runInEmpty} Launch the task once, without the TLD argument.
|
|
* <li>{@code exclude} TLDs to exclude.
|
|
* <li>{@code jitterSeconds} Randomly delay each task by up to this many seconds.
|
|
* <li>Any other parameters specified will be passed through as POST parameters to the called task.
|
|
* </ul>
|
|
*
|
|
* <h3>Patharg Reference</h3>
|
|
*
|
|
* <p>The following values may be specified inside the "endpoint" param.
|
|
* <ul>
|
|
* <li>{@code :tld} Substituted with an ASCII tld, if tld fanout is enabled.
|
|
* This patharg is mostly useful for aesthetic purposes, since tasks are already namespaced.
|
|
* </ul>
|
|
*/
